Key management in IoT scenarios faces several new challenges compared to traditional IT environments:
Scalability: IoT networks often involve millions of devices, making it difficult to securely generate, distribute, and manage keys at scale. For example, a smart city with thousands of sensors requires a robust key management system to handle device authentication and encryption. Tencent Cloud's Key Management Service (KMS) provides scalable solutions for secure key storage and lifecycle management, suitable for large-scale IoT deployments.
Device Resource Constraints: Many IoT devices have limited computational power and memory, making complex cryptographic operations challenging. Lightweight encryption algorithms and efficient key management protocols are needed. Tencent Cloud offers lightweight security solutions optimized for resource-constrained devices.
Dynamic Network Topology: IoT devices frequently join or leave networks, requiring dynamic key updates and revocation. For instance, a fleet of connected vehicles may require frequent key rotations to maintain security. Tencent Cloud's KMS supports automated key rotation and revocation, ensuring secure communication in dynamic environments.
Physical Security Risks: IoT devices are often deployed in unsecured locations, making them vulnerable to physical attacks that could extract keys. Secure key storage mechanisms, such as hardware security modules (HSMs), are essential. Tencent Cloud provides HSM solutions to protect sensitive keys from unauthorized access.
Interoperability: IoT ecosystems often involve devices from multiple vendors, requiring standardized key management protocols. Tencent Cloud supports industry-standard protocols like TLS and MQTT with integrated key management, ensuring compatibility across diverse IoT platforms.
Privacy and Compliance: IoT data often includes sensitive personal or industrial information, requiring strict key management to comply with regulations like GDPR. Tencent Cloud's KMS helps meet compliance requirements by providing audit logs and secure key policies.
Example: A smart agriculture system with soil sensors and drones needs secure key management to protect data transmissions. Tencent Cloud's KMS can automate key distribution and rotation, ensuring secure communication between devices while scaling to thousands of endpoints.